sound-juicer r2151 - in trunk: . data po src
- From: rburton svn gnome org
- To: svn-commits-list gnome org
- Subject: sound-juicer r2151 - in trunk: . data po src
- Date: Sun, 13 Apr 2008 16:56:05 +0100 (BST)
Author: rburton
Date: Sun Apr 13 16:56:05 2008
New Revision: 2151
URL: http://svn.gnome.org/viewvc/sound-juicer?rev=2151&view=rev
Log:
2008-04-13 Ross Burton <ross burtonini com>
* configure.in:
Bump GTK+ dependency to 2.12.
* src/Makefile.am:
* src/bacon-volume.[ch]:
* po/POTFILES.in:
Remove BaconVolume widget.
* data/sound-juicer.glade:
* src/sj-main.c:
* src/sj-play.[ch]:
Use GtkVolumeButton (#518753, thanks Michael Terry)
Removed:
trunk/src/bacon-volume.c
trunk/src/bacon-volume.h
Modified:
trunk/ChangeLog
trunk/configure.in
trunk/data/sound-juicer.glade
trunk/po/POTFILES.in
trunk/src/Makefile.am
trunk/src/sj-main.c
trunk/src/sj-play.c
trunk/src/sj-play.h
Modified: trunk/configure.in
==============================================================================
--- trunk/configure.in (original)
+++ trunk/configure.in Sun Apr 13 16:56:05 2008
@@ -51,7 +51,7 @@
LIBS="$oldlibs"
# Find the UI libraries
-PKG_CHECK_MODULES(UI, gtk+-2.0 >= 2.8 libglade-2.0 gconf-2.0 libgnomeui-2.0 >= 2.13.0 gnome-vfs-2.0 >= 2.9 gnome-vfs-module-2.0 > 2.9 gmodule-export-2.0 dbus-glib-1)
+PKG_CHECK_MODULES(UI, gtk+-2.0 >= 2.12 libglade-2.0 gconf-2.0 libgnomeui-2.0 >= 2.13.0 gnome-vfs-2.0 >= 2.9 gnome-vfs-module-2.0 > 2.9 gmodule-export-2.0 dbus-glib-1)
AC_SUBST(UI_CFLAGS)
AC_SUBST(UI_LIBS)
Modified: trunk/data/sound-juicer.glade
==============================================================================
--- trunk/data/sound-juicer.glade (original)
+++ trunk/data/sound-juicer.glade Sun Apr 13 16:56:05 2008
@@ -542,7 +542,7 @@
<child>
<widget class="Custom" id="volume_button">
<property name="visible">True</property>
- <property name="creation_function">sj_make_volume_button</property>
+ <property name="creation_function">gtk_volume_button_new</property>
<signal name="value_changed" handler="on_volume_changed"/>
</widget>
<packing>
Modified: trunk/po/POTFILES.in
==============================================================================
--- trunk/po/POTFILES.in (original)
+++ trunk/po/POTFILES.in Sun Apr 13 16:56:05 2008
@@ -11,7 +11,6 @@
libjuicer/sj-metadata-musicbrainz.c
libjuicer/sj-structures.c
libjuicer/sj-util.c
-src/bacon-volume.c
src/gconf-bridge.c
src/sj-about.c
src/sj-extracting.c
Modified: trunk/src/Makefile.am
==============================================================================
--- trunk/src/Makefile.am (original)
+++ trunk/src/Makefile.am Sun Apr 13 16:56:05 2008
@@ -21,8 +21,6 @@
gedit-message-area.c \
gconf-bridge.h \
gconf-bridge.c \
- bacon-volume.c \
- bacon-volume.h \
$(BACON_FILES)
sound_juicer_CPPFLAGS = \
Modified: trunk/src/sj-main.c
==============================================================================
--- trunk/src/sj-main.c (original)
+++ trunk/src/sj-main.c Sun Apr 13 16:56:05 2008
@@ -54,7 +54,6 @@
#include "sj-play.h"
#include "sj-genres.h"
#include "gedit-message-area.h"
-#include "bacon-volume.h"
gboolean on_delete_event (GtkWidget *widget, GdkEvent *event, gpointer user_data);
@@ -791,9 +790,9 @@
GtkWidget *volb = glade_xml_get_widget (glade, "volume_button");
if (entry->value == NULL) {
- bacon_volume_button_set_value (BACON_VOLUME_BUTTON (volb), 1.0);
+ gtk_scale_button_set_value (GTK_SCALE_BUTTON (volb), 1.0);
} else {
- bacon_volume_button_set_value (BACON_VOLUME_BUTTON (volb), gconf_value_get_float (entry->value));
+ gtk_scale_button_set_value (GTK_SCALE_BUTTON (volb), gconf_value_get_float (entry->value));
}
}
@@ -1468,15 +1467,6 @@
}
}
-GtkWidget *
-sj_make_volume_button (void)
-{
- GtkWidget *w = bacon_volume_button_new (GTK_ICON_SIZE_SMALL_TOOLBAR,
- 0.0, 1.0, 0.02);
- bacon_volume_button_set_value (BACON_VOLUME_BUTTON (w), 1.0);
- return w;
-}
-
static void
upgrade_gconf (void)
{
Modified: trunk/src/sj-play.c
==============================================================================
--- trunk/src/sj-play.c (original)
+++ trunk/src/sj-play.c Sun Apr 13 16:56:05 2008
@@ -33,7 +33,6 @@
#include <gtk/gtkstatusbar.h>
#include <gtk/gtkmessagedialog.h>
-#include "bacon-volume.h"
#include "sound-juicer.h"
#include "sj-play.h"
@@ -585,9 +584,9 @@
*/
void
-on_volume_changed (GtkWidget * volb, gpointer data)
+on_volume_changed (GtkWidget * volb, gdouble value, gpointer data)
{
- vol = bacon_volume_button_get_value (BACON_VOLUME_BUTTON (volb));
+ vol = value;
if (pipeline) {
GstElement *volume;
Modified: trunk/src/sj-play.h
==============================================================================
--- trunk/src/sj-play.h (original)
+++ trunk/src/sj-play.h Sun Apr 13 16:56:05 2008
@@ -45,7 +45,7 @@
void on_tracklist_row_selected (GtkTreeView *treeview,
gpointer user_data);
-void on_volume_changed (GtkWidget* volb, gpointer data);
+void on_volume_changed (GtkWidget* volb, gdouble value, gpointer data);
gboolean on_seek_press (GtkWidget * scale,
GdkEventButton * event,
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]